    Fantastic mod. The only issue I've run into is that the custom combos can sometimes lead to you doing a different attack than you intended, which is why I've never really liked that type of system.

    For example: The normal charged heavy is very powerful, and there will be situations where you'll want to do that attack within a tight window of opportunity. However, if you try to do this following a light attack, even if you take a moment to pause in between, you'll end up doing the three pokes instead and your damage suffers as a result.

    For that reason, as cool as the custom combos are, I just don't know if they're practical for a game like this where you need to know exactly what will happen every time you press a button.

    There is 1 minor oddity. The weapon can still be buffed but all buffs are removed/overwritten by various attacks of the weapon (1H 2nd Light attack removes buffs, 2H 3rd Light Attack removes buffs, etc). Looks like those attacks apply momentary buffs of their own that overwrite any weapon buff or vow.

    Another note for those merging:
    In v1.1 regulation.bin, I believe the author's description is off for SpEffectParam (like perhaps the list is from a previous version of the mod?).  Specifically, I noticed that only the following SpEffectParam param ids had been changed in this mod from 1.07.1: 1681,1683,1811,1813

    The other regulation.bin changes matched what was listed in the author's description.

    Hope this helps others to enjoy this mod! :)

      Okay, did various diffs between v1, v1.1 (full 1.2GB), and v1.1 (no menu) downloads.

      c0000 in v1.1 (no menu) doesn’t have the animations.  c0000 in the others seem to.  Since a single tae has changed from v1 to v1.1 (full 1.2GB), I copied the c0000 from v1.1 (full 1.2GB) into v1.1 (no menu), and my updated v1.1 (no menu) now seems to work properly.  I say seems to as I only tried it for 2 minutes, but I now see the new moveset and animations.

      Hope that helps folks!
